Abstract :
Independed power supply plan worked out on the ";;Renewable energy sources and hydro-power engineering";; department. It capacity is up to 30 kw and it is developed on the basis of renewable energy sources plant base modules combined use of small hydroelectric power station by capacity up to 10 kw, wind power station by capacity up to 8 kw and daily regulation pneumohydraulic accumulators. Energy plant\´s plan determinations with the various energy accumulation system\´s solutions are in the report. The methods of estimation wind and hydraulic energy potential with reference to a place of electrical energy use are considered. Parameters substantiation models, modes of independent energy supply system with energy accumulation routine are analyzed on the basis of combined wind power station and hydroelectric power station use.
